Enhancing P2P live streaming performance by balancing description distribution and available forwarding bandwidth in P2P streaming network

被引:10
|
作者
Lin, Chow-Sing [1 ]
机构
[1] Natl Univ Tainan, Dept Comp Sci & Informat Engn, Tainan 700, Taiwan
关键词
live streaming; peer-to-peer; multiple description coding; balancing; failure recovery;
D O I
10.1002/dac.1173
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
In a peer-to-peer (P2P) network, peers not only receive services from the network, but also contribute their own resources to the network. The abundant resources brought by P2P networks have stimulated the wide deployment of resource-consuming multimedia streaming services over a P2P architecture. Allowing for the heterogeneity of peers in their upload and download bandwidth, most researches adopt the Multiple Description Coding (MDC) technique to enable differentiated streaming services. However, due to the lack of a global view of description availability, they tend to cause the skewed distribution of descriptions and lead to the under-utilization of aggregated resources on P2P networks. In the paper, we propose a novel approach to balance the distribution of descriptions and available upload bandwidth in the P2P live streaming network. Based on the description distribution and available upload bandwidth, the proposed balancing scheme determines what descriptions a new peer should receive and their source peers such that better system scalability can be achieved. The simulation experiments indicate that our proposed balancing scheme can effectively reduce the server bandwidth consumption and rejection rate. Furthermore, abandoned peers can recover their lost descriptions mostly from the existing peers in the network instead of the server. Copyright (C) 2010 John Wiley & Sons, Ltd.
引用
收藏
页码:568 / 585
页数:18
相关论文
共 50 条
  • [1] Enhancing P2P overlay network architecture for live multimedia streaming
    Huang, Nen-Fu
    Tzang, Yih-Jou
    Chang, Hong-Yi
    Ho, Chia-Wen
    INFORMATION SCIENCES, 2010, 180 (17) : 3210 - 3231
  • [2] Network Coding For P2P Live Media Streaming
    Liu, Han
    Tu, Xiaodong
    Xie, Jun
    2008 IFIP INTERNATIONAL CONFERENCE ON NETWORK AND PARALLEL COMPUTING, PROCEEDINGS, 2008, : 392 - 398
  • [3] Scalable control of bandwidth resources in P2P live streaming
    Efthymiopoulou, Maria
    Efthymiopoulos, Nikolaos
    Christakidis, Athanasios
    Denazis, Spyros
    Koufopavlou, Odysseas
    2014 22ND MEDITERRANEAN CONFERENCE ON CONTROL AND AUTOMATION (MED), 2014, : 792 - 797
  • [4] Network Awareness of P2P Live Streaming Applications
    Ciullo, Delia
    Garcia, Maria Antonieta
    Horvath, Akos
    Leonardi, Emilio
    Mellia, Marco
    Rossi, Dario
    Telek, Miklos
    Veglia, Paolo
    2009 IEEE INTERNATIONAL SYMPOSIUM ON PARALLEL & DISTRIBUTED PROCESSING, VOLS 1-5, 2009, : 1775 - +
  • [5] P2P Live Video Streaming in WebRTC
    Rhinow, Florian
    Veloso, Pablo Porto
    Puyelo, Carlos
    Barrett, Stephen
    Nuallain, Eamonn O.
    2014 WORLD CONGRESS ON COMPUTER APPLICATIONS AND INFORMATION SYSTEMS (WCCAIS), 2014,
  • [6] On Demand Heterogeneity in P2P Live Streaming
    Ouyang, Zhipeng
    Xu, Lisong
    Ramamurthy, Byrav
    2010 IEEE INTERNATIONAL CONFERENCE ON COMMUNICATIONS, 2010,
  • [7] Robust and Scalable P2P Live Streaming
    陈锬
    熊馨
    Journal of Donghua University(English Edition), 2009, 26 (05) : 482 - 488
  • [8] Hybrid Live P2P Streaming Protocol
    Hammami, Chourouk
    Jemili, Imen
    Gazdar, Achraf
    Belghith, Abdelfettah
    Mosbah, Mohamed
    5TH INTERNATIONAL CONFERENCE ON AMBIENT SYSTEMS, NETWORKS AND TECHNOLOGIES (ANT-2014), THE 4TH INTERNATIONAL CONFERENCE ON SUSTAINABLE ENERGY INFORMATION TECHNOLOGY (SEIT-2014), 2014, 32 : 158 - 165
  • [9] Research on P2P live streaming system
    Wu, Gongcai
    Wu, Gongxin
    2011 INTERNATIONAL CONFERENCE ON ELECTRONICS, COMMUNICATIONS AND CONTROL (ICECC), 2011, : 1631 - 1634
  • [10] LiquidStream—network dependent dynamic P2P live streaming
    Nikolaos Efthymiopoulos
    Athanasios Christakidis
    Spyros Denazis
    Odysseas Koufopavlou
    Peer-to-Peer Networking and Applications, 2011, 4 : 50 - 62